The efficient use of materials is of great importance, and the choice of the basic topology for the design of structures and mechanical elements is crucial for the performance of sizing of shape optimization. This volume provides a comprehensive review of the state of the art in topology design, spanning fundamental mathematical, mechanical and implementation issues. Topology design of discrete structures involves large scale computational problems and the need to select structural elements from a discrete set of possibilities. The formulation and solution of discrete design problems are described, including new applications of genetic algorithms and dual methods. For continuum problems the emphasis is on the `homogenization method', which employs composite materials as the basis for defining shape in terms of material density, unifying macroscopic structural design optimization and micromechanics. All aspects of this field are covered, including computational aspects and the use of the homogenization method in a computer-aided design environment.
